SYSTEMS AND APPARATUS FOR MICROMIRROR DESIGNS WITH ELECTRODE CONTACT

    Abstract: Systems and Apparatus for micromirror designs with electrode contact. In some examples, a micromirror including a mirror, a mirror via coupled to the mirror, a hinge coupled to the mirror via, the hinge including a springtip associated with a first side of the micromirror, the springtip associated with a first terminal, and an electrode associated with the first side of the micromirror, the electrode having a dielectric coating in contact with the springtip, the electrode associated with a second terminal different than the first terminal.

    Abstract: Described examples include a device includes a first post and a spring supported by the first post. The device also includes a second post coupled to the spring and a mirror on the second post. Additionally, the device includes a movable layer coupled to the spring and to the mirror and a fixed layer, where the movable layer is between the fixed layer and the mirror. The mirror has a width and a length and the length is greater than the width. The mirror is configured to move based on a voltage difference between the movable layer and the fixed layer.

    Abstract: A microelectromechanical actuator for a light beam steering device is provided that includes memory cells coupled to at least one electronic circuitry component and electrode segments coupled to a respective one of the memory cells via the at least one electronic circuitry component. A flexible metal layer having support pillars is on the electrode segments. Flexible beams are attached to the support pillars and a movable electrode attaches to the flexible beams. A mirror is attached to the movable electrode. When one or more of the electrode segments is activated, the mirror is displaced a distance to steer a light beam output from a light source in a direction.

    Abstract: Described examples include apparatus having a driving electrode on a substrate. The apparatus has a platform suspended above the driving electrode and conductively coupled to a platform electrode, where the platform is configured to move in a direction perpendicular to a surface of the substrate in response to a voltage difference applied between the driving electrode and the platform electrode. The apparatus also has a mirror post on the platform. The apparatus has a mirror coupled to the platform by the mirror post, where the mirror is rectangular.
